Ambroise Paul Toussaint Jules Valéry (October 30, 1871 – July 20, 1945) was a French poet, essayist, and philosopher from Sète, France. He was known for his significant contributions to poetry, fiction, and aphorisms spanning art, history, and letters. Valéry's intellectual curiosity shaped a lasting legacy in French literature and thought.

Early Life and Origins

Paul Valéry was born on October 30, 1871, in Sète, France. This coastal town provided the setting for his early years. His formative experiences in Sète undoubtedly shaped his perspective.

2 kapitulua· 2. kapitulua 7tik

Career Beginnings

Valéry embarked on a varied intellectual journey, engaging in multiple professions throughout his career. He was known as a writer, poet, university teacher, journalist, literary critic, philosopher, essayist, and librettist. These diverse roles highlight his broad intellectual curiosity and artistic versatility.
